求赐教,一道javajava 数组赋值题!

(1)这个小题简单,只是java 数组赋值元素嘚比较.

(2)解码的算法是这样的:

1 定义一个java 数组赋值B,元素全部设为 n,表示还没解码

内循环j:n-1开始递减

从java 数组赋值编码A的最右边开始扫描

在j位置递减过程中如果在碰到B中已赋值(不等于n)的数据前就已经在A中j位置找的等于m的数据,则将i赋给B的j位置.

  如果找不到那么每碰到一个已賦值(不等于n)的数据,m就减1,再继续向前扫描值到碰到在B中没有赋值,而在A中又跟m匹配的位置将i赋给B的这个位置.

  呵呵,好像有點拗口.经过纸上运算应该是正确的.有时间我再编出来.

[此贴子已经被作者于 23:16:16编辑过]

}

//直接可以用的!!!

//记得加分(⊙o⊙)哦

}

楼上砍甘蔗有道理只要把第一節和第二节连接起来既可

他就像一根甘蔗,有10节你要是砍掉一节他就成了2跟甘蔗了

用arrayList存放你的数据吧,它可以实现你的功能

他们就像容器你可以仍很多的石头进去,也可以拿出来

java 数组赋值出生到死就固定长度的

}

我要回帖

更多关于 java数组 的文章

更多推荐

版权声明:文章内容来源于网络,版权归原作者所有,如有侵权请点击这里与我们联系,我们将及时删除。

点击添加站长微信